
Java商城二次开发 - 译码科技 二维码
1
Java商城二次开发 - 译码科技 ──────────────────────────────────────────────────────────────────────────────── Java商城二次开发:基于开源源码的业务快速落地方案引言在电商行业竞争日益激烈的今天,很多企业已经完成了初期的商城搭建,却面临着业务快速迭代带来的定制化需求挑战:现有商城功能无法满足新的营销玩法、多渠道对接需求不匹配、现有系统扩展性不足无法支撑业务增长……对于已经选择Java技术栈的企业来说,Java商城二次开发成为了平衡成本、效率与定制化需求的最优解。 依托成熟的开源商城源码进行二次开发,既可以避免从零搭建系统的高昂成本,又能快速响应业务的个性化需求,这也是越来越多企业选择这种模式的核心原因。译码科技作为专注Java技术栈电商解决方案的服务商,凭借多年的开源项目开发经验,能够为企业提供高效稳定的Java商城二次开发服务,帮助企业快速落地业务创新。 什么是Java商城二次开发Java作为企业级应用开发最主流的编程语言,凭借跨平台、高并发、安全稳定的特性,一直是大中型电商平台的首选技术栈。Java商城二次开发指的是在现有Java商城源码基础上,根据企业的个性化业务需求,进行功能新增、模块修改、性能优化、对接扩展等开发工作,最终得到符合业务要求的定制化电商系统。 为什么选择基于开源的二次开发模式当前市面上有大量成熟稳定的Java开源商城项目,涵盖了B2C、B2B、O2O等多种电商模式,已经内置了商品管理、订单处理、支付对接、用户管理等核心基础功能。基于开源源码进行Java商城二次开发,相比从零开始搭建,有三大核心优势: 1. 降低开发成本:基础通用功能已经经过大量项目验证,不需要重复开发,企业只需要为定制化功能支付成本,整体开发成本可以降低60%以上。 2. 缩短上线周期:成熟开源项目已经完成了基础架构搭建和核心功能测试,开发团队只需要聚焦于个性化需求开发,上线周期可以从几个月压缩到几周。 3. 架构灵活性强:主流Java开源商城普遍采用微服务、前后端分离等现代化架构,具备良好的扩展性,可以轻松应对后续业务增长带来的系统迭代需求。 对于想要快速试错、快速推新的电商企业来说,这种模式完美平衡了定制化需求和成本效率,是当前阶段性价比最高的电商系统升级方案。 Java商城二次开发的常见业务场景企业进行Java商城二次开发的需求往往来自业务增长和模式创新,译码科技在服务客户的过程中,总结了几类最常见的二次开发场景: 营销功能定制开发电商行业的营销玩法更新速度极快,从早期的满减折扣、优惠券,到现在的直播带货、社群分销、拼团秒杀、积分商城等,很多早期搭建的Java商城往往没有内置这些新功能。通过Java商城二次开发,可以快速将符合当前营销需求的功能集成到现有系统中,不需要更换整体系统,避免了数据迁移和用户迁移的风险。 多渠道对接适配当前电商已经进入全渠道运营时代,企业需要对接微信小程序、抖音小店、视频号橱窗、第三方ERP、仓储物流系统、CRM客户管理系统等多个第三方平台。很多早期的Java商城只支持PC端和H5端,无法满足全渠道对接需求,通过二次开发可以完成接口适配和数据打通,实现多渠道数据统一管理,提升运营效率。 性能与安全优化随着商城用户量和订单量的增长,原有Java商城可能会出现响应慢、并发支持不足等问题,同时老旧系统也可能存在安全漏洞。通过二次开发可以进行架构优化、数据库分库分表、缓存优化、漏洞修复等工作,提升系统的稳定性和安全性,支撑大促等高并发场景。 商业模式升级改造很多企业最初搭建的是B2C零售商城,随着业务发展需要拓展B2B批发、S2B2C供应链、社交电商等新模式,原有商城的业务逻辑无法匹配新的模式,通过Java商城二次开发可以在原有技术架构基础上升级业务模块,保护原有技术投入的同时实现商业模式升级。 译码科技Java商城二次开发的服务优势作为专注Java电商领域的技术服务团队,译码科技的Java商城二次开发服务始终围绕“快速响应、稳定可靠、保护投资”三个核心目标,为企业提供全流程的开发支持。 首先,我们深度适配主流Java开源商城源码,包括但不限于iBase4J、ShopXO、Mall4j等主流开源项目,开发团队对这些开源项目的架构、源码逻辑有深入理解,能够快速定位开发点,避免踩坑,大幅缩短开发周期。 其次,我们遵循标准化的Java开发规范,二次开发过程中会保留原有开源项目的可升级性,不会对核心架构做侵入式修改,后续用户仍然可以同步开源项目的官方更新,同时我们会提供完整的开发文档和源码注释,方便企业后续自主维护。 最后,我们能够快速响应企业的业务需求,从需求对接、方案设计、代码开发到测试上线,建立了完整的项目管理流程,一般中小型定制需求可以在1-4周内完成上线,匹配电商业务快速迭代的节奏。 在实际项目中,我们曾经为一家区域零售企业在现有开源Java商城基础上,开发了社群分销+到店自提功能,仅用2周就完成开发上线,帮助客户在节庆促销期间实现订单量增长45%,系统稳定无故障,获得了客户的高度认可。 Java商城二次开发的注意事项很多企业在进行二次开发的过程中,容易陷入一些误区,导致开发效果达不到预期:
第一,不要选择非开源的闭源商城进行二次开发,闭源商城往往没有完整的源码授权,也不允许修改核心代码,后续开发会受到很多限制,而开源商城不仅源码开放,还有庞大的社区支持,遇到问题可以快速解决。 第二,要优先选择符合Java开发规范、架构清晰的开源项目,不要选择多年没有维护的陈旧项目,否则后续二次开发的技术债务会非常高,影响系统的长期稳定性。 第三,二次开发要尽量遵循开闭原则,对原有核心代码的修改要尽量少,核心功能尽量通过插件化的方式集成,避免后续升级出现兼容性问题。 总结Java商城二次开发已经成为很多电商企业实现业务快速创新的重要途径,基于开源源码的开发模式,既帮助企业控制了成本,又能满足个性化的业务需求,是中小电商企业和传统企业转型电商的高性价比选择。 译码科技凭借多年的Java技术积累和开源项目服务经验,能够为企业提供从需求调研到上线运维的全流程Java商城二次开发服务,快速响应业务变化,帮助企业在电商竞争中抢占先机。如果你正在面临现有商城功能不足、业务迭代缓慢的问题,不妨考虑基于开源的Java商城二次开发方案,用更低的成本实现业务的快速增长。 声明:此篇为南京译码网络科技有限公司原创文章,转载请标明出处链接:https://www.njyima.com/sys-nd/2086.html
|